Chapter 1
Grissom left the interrogation room and sprinted to his car. He was now racing the clock. He had to make it in time.
Once at the school, he practically leapt from the car before it came to a complete stop. As he raced down the steps to the school, his heart sank as he saw Dominick coming out of the school carrying a small box.
"Dominick!" Grissom yelled, "Put it down! It's active!"
Unfortunately, it was too late. The bomb went off, instantly killing Dominick and throwing Grissom backwards. He slowly sat up and looked at what was left of Dominick. Pieces of debris were everywhere, and it made Grissom sick to see all of the destruction.
As he continued to survey the damage, he began to take notice of his own injuries. His elbow was bleeding and there were a few cuts that were stinging his face and hands. His head was throbbing and when Grissom reached back to feel it, he was surprised to find his hand covered in blood. He shook his head as he attempted to ignore the pain and dizziness. However, as he stood, he was instantly reminded. His world began to spin and Grissom became quite light-headed. A passing officer helped him to steady himself.
"I'm fine...just a little shook up. That's all." he assured the officer, who nodded and walked away. Grissom looked at Dominick's body again and saw the blood. Suddenly his usually iron stomach turned and he felt like he was going to be sick. Instead another wave of dizziness caused him to collapse and black out.
